deleting myself(taks) ettiquette question

I know I can have a task delete itself by calling  vTaskDelete(NULL).  should I add a forever loop after it just in case?  For example:
vTaskDelete(NULL);  //NULL means me!
for(;;) ;  //should never get here
or is it not necessary? thanks!

deleting myself(taks) ettiquette question

It’s not necessary.

deleting myself(taks) ettiquette question

thanks!